  • The MILWAUKEE® M12™ AIRSNAKE™ Drain Cleaning Air Gun is the industry's only drain cleaning machine designed to clear through drain covers and traps with powered air. The cordless air gun enables users to clear clogged drains while leaving fixtures and drain covers intact. The tool is designed for 1"-4" drain lines and has the power to clear up to 35 ft. past vent stacks and tees. The drain cleaning air gun has a variable pressure dial providing complete control when working on delicate pipe systems. Powered air flushes water out of pipes, completely removing grease and sludge from pipe walls. Drain professionals, plumbers, and facility maintenance will be able to work faster when clearing clogs with the ability to work over sinks and eliminate retrieval mess. The M12™ AIRSNAKE™ is powered by Milwaukee M12™ REDLITHIUM™ battery packs, providing more work per charge and more work over pack life. Built-in REDLINK™ Intelligence gives optimized performance and overload protection against abusive situations.

    @BrodiePlumbing 3 года назад +35

    I have one of these but made by General. It rarely gets used, because it rarely works. And if your lucky you won't get sprayed with whatever is in the sink. The problem with these is most of the energy goes up the vent and not down the drain, also when it does work it's very temporary as it usually will only pop an tiny hole in the blockage and not actually clear it out. This tool is completely useless on a kitchen grease blockage. The only place where it can be used successfully is a basin drain and a floor drain.

    @jefflatten9321 Год назад +2

    Some of you are totally missing the point. I don't think this tool is meant to clear clogged lines where vents are in place...the pressure will blow out of the vent if it's upstream from the clog. Same for clogged toilets. Now, where is this tool useful? We live in Puerto Rico, where flat roofs with drains buried in the walls are all too common, and it's not unusual for one or more drains to clog from leaves, crap or mango pits falling in. We usually put a coil of coat hanger wire in the entry to block the mango pits We just had a clog, and it looked like the problem was tree roots blocking the pipe at just below grade. We were getting ready to bust concrete and dig it up when I decided to call the local company that specializes in this work, they showed up with one of these Milwaukee guns and in 5 minutes they blew the drain clear. A rusted off piece of wire had entered the drain and miscellaneous junk had formed a block behind it. Snaking or ramming it accomplished nothing....it looked like there were at least two elbows in the way. The Milwaukee did it in two shots. The right tool for the job is hard to beat.
